Subject: [themirror] DT is DT !!!
This is my 1st time sending anything in to anymailing list, but I could not
hold back anymore...I want to address a couple of topics.
1st-
All this noise about OIALT! This ia a Live album!
Recorded just the way a live album should be...pretty much the way it happened.
If you start remixing to fine tune vocals etc...you now have a studio album and
not a true live one...kinda like a Frampton Comes Alive...not a true live
album. OIALT is a great true live album, vocal screeches and all.
2nd-
The problem with radio stations playing DT stems from DT's record label not
promoting to R&R stations nation wide. I'm sure in select few, high rated
area's DT is plyed quite often...here in AZ the answer I received to the
question, "How come you do not play DT?", I was told if the record company
does not promote it to us...we just don't have the time.
3rd-
Commerical success does not mean DT would be selling out!!! I can here
progressiveness in even the most mellow song they have. If DT was to loose
there style that has made them what they are, and become say something like
Genesis ( older vs. latter) then I can understand thinking they have sold out.
DT is still doing it as well now as they have before. Just listen to OIALT and
here how well old and new blend together.
